Sharing and application

In sharing Christ others – has to begin with action. Our lifestyles are most evident to the people around us and how our actions are by themselves lifestyle evangelism. There is a need to walk the talk – in showing love and encouragement, however hard and futile this may seems at times.

But the gospel has to be verbalized as well. Few ways of sharing Christ with friends:

– Try to talk shop first before slowly easing the conversation towards the Gospel. If the other party wants to share about his religion be open to hearing and finding out about what makes him believe in his religion. (Marcus)
– Share one-on-one. Write cards to encourage her non-Christian friends, putting in Bible verses.(Felly)
– By logical arguments and reasoning.

Observation: Important to order our thoughts. It’s alright even if our friends do not appear too receptive or enthusiastic to hear more, as long they remain open that leaves a door open for us to re-visit the Gospel message with them.

Also, when it comes to sharing logical arguments, there is a need to understand that logic can only help a person see and understand up to a certain extent. Logical arguments strengthen our faith but we should never depend on them as a sole mean for sharing the gospel. Prayer and intercession are essential in reaching out to those yet unsaved.

What is/are the most difficult thing/s about showing love in your life now?

– Don't feel like showing love at that moment in time, i.e. feeling tired, etc.
– Having the expectation that you will be loved in return or see some change in the other party you are trying to love
– Difficult to make the first move. Some friends care too much about your appearance first, before they even bother about receiving or appreciating the things you do for them.

Observation: Feeding on the Word constantly helps us with our desire to show love; God works in us even in our will. We will come to that later in Philippains.
The part about appearance is very true, and there is no easy way around it but to keep in mind that what we do, we do for God.
